The ruins of Hampi. Hampi was the capital of Vijayanagar, a 14th century empire. Its fabulously rich princes built Dravidian temples and palaces which won the admiration of travelers between the 14th and 16th centuries. Now in ruins, Hampi is a UNESCO World Heritage Site, listed as the Group of Monuments at Hampi.
